Title:
IN-CAR PULSE RADAR
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2011/122268
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
Provided is an in-car pulse radar capable of detecting an object information with high accuracy while preventing the noise signal from being mixed into a received signal by providing a delay time to separate both signals time-sequentially with a simple configuration. A base band signal which is down-converted by a frequency converter (152) is outputted to a signal processing part (102) via a board-to-board connector (103) after passing through a delay circuit (153). Further, a control signal is outputted to a switch circuit (151) from a control signal generating part (162) via the board-to-board connector (103). The delay circuit (153) increases the time difference from the time when the control signal passes through the board-to board connector (103) to the time when the baseband signal passes through the board-to-board connector (103) by providing a given delay time to the baseband signal. Thus, the baseband signal is not subjected to the interference from the control signal.
